  • Quick Install 

Screw piles and spiral anchors are typically installed using traditional construction machinery such as truck excavators and mini excavators with properly sized low-speed high torque hydraulic motors. There is no need to move special equipment such as cranes with pile hammers or large drilling rigs. This allows for quick and inexpensive mobilization. The contractor can respond quickly and be on site. 

  • Immediate load-bearing 

Screw piles and spiral anchors are unique among all foundations so, that they can be loaded immediately after installation. You don't have to wait for the concrete or mortar to harden, and you don't have to wait for stakeout until the pore water pressure is released excessively. 

  • Minimal Construction Site Impairment 

Compared to most other construction activities where driven piles, bores, or other anchor systems are installed, screw pile and screw anchor installations cause little or no construction site impairment. Especially when installing screw piles and screw anchors, there are usually no floor cut-outs. This keeps the sites clean, requires minimal cleaning at each installation site after installation, and usually reduces project costs. 

  • Installation supervision and load-bearing capacity verification during assembly

One of the most important characteristics of the screw pile and spiral anchor is load-bearing capacity verification during assembly. In some cases, this is similar to monitoring the installation of driven piles with a pile-driving analyser during installation. This is possible by using an in-line direct torque meter that measures the installation torque as the pile/anchor penetrates the ground.

  • Installation in high groundwater conditions 

Screw piles and spiral anchors usually do not require excavation for installation. When used to support existing structures, shallow excavation may be required to expose the existing foundation. 

  • Simple bay changes to increase bearing capacity 

One of the other unique characteristics of highly versatile thread piles and thread anchors is the ability to quickly change the composition of thread elements to increase bearing capacity. This is partially achieved by the modularity of the technology. 

  • Low Carbon Footprint-Sustainable Technology 

Many companies of screw piles and screw anchors use high quality recycled steel for their production for the low carbon print. This saves natural resources and energy and reduces overall carbon dioxide emissions. Screw piles and helical anchors are good for supporting temporary structures because they can be easily removed and reused with little change in structural integrity.
